I have $150k invested in index funds and target retirement funds. I also have a couple hundred shares of several REITs that pay 7-10% dividends. I net about $10k annual in investment returns, which will compound and grow for me over time.

I also have a couple grand into ethereum, purchased at $9-13, but I'm not touching any of that for a long time yet, so I don't really track my returns on that investment. It's probably worth about $7500 at this point, assuming eth is still around $40 in value.

I don't work for any of this. It literally just grows. I don't touch it, or think about it, that capital just pays me dividends once a quarter or so. That is the definition of passive income.
